Summary

We are recruiting 3 Administrative post based in Peterborough or Aberdeen. Administrative staff are based either within the Administrative Services team or with the other corporate services teams (HR, and Governance and Accountability).

Post Duties could include
  • Arranging travel and accommodation for members of the Executive Leadership team and Joint Committee.
  • Assisting with the organisation of meetings and events and providing support during these
  • Using the Finance system for payment of invoices
  • Checking travel and subsistence claims, entering claims onto the finance system.
  • Updating information on the intranet or SharePoint Sites
  • Proof reading and formatting documents

Inverdee House (IH) Aberdeen office specific-
  • Assisting Office Manager as required in all relative office administrative functions relating to the running, security, health, and safety of the office
  • Support JNCC IH Office Manager with Environmental work for ISO 14001 and Defra sustainability reporting
  • Providing cover for the office manager
  • Undertaking health and safety roles including First Aid and Fire Marshal duties
  • Provide backup for IT carrying out tape changes and provision of IT equipment for staff and meetings as required
  • Provide local DSE assessor support
  • Managing office mail and shipments to support staff and dispersed working
  • Provide basic training to new staff on systems and processes such as travel and finance.
  • Assist as required with the work involved in relation to dispersed working
  • Providing back up and assistance to all other staff and teams as required
  • Any other duties as may be necessary

HR specific-
  • Providing a recruitment service, including uploading vacancies on to an Applicant Tracking System and placing adverts, carrying out all recruitment administration processes within agreed guidelines and timeframes, ensuring application forms and the further particulars are dispatched, board papers are prepared, and recruitment files and the tracking spreadsheet are maintained.
  • Ensuring that all necessary actions, documentation and general administrative tasks are completed for new starters and leavers.
  • Covering the HR and Recruitment inbox as part of a rota
  • Processing monthly payroll information
  • Entering data onto the HR System (OpenHR) and providing information / management reporting where necessary

Governance and Accountability specific -
  • Collation and presentation of information/data as directed by the Personal Assistants.
  • Providing annual leave cover, including diary management, email management and secretariat duties, for the Personal Assistants.
  • Assisting with tasks as directed by the Senior Personal Assistant.

Hours of work
Normal minimum hours of attendance for full time posts are 36 hours per week over a 5-day period, Monday to Friday. Flexi time is available. This post may also be suitable for job share.

Annual Leave Entitlement
The annual leave allowance is 25 days per year, rising to 30 days per year after 5 years service. There are also 12 days public and privilege leave. Part time staff will receive this on a pro rata basis.

About Disability Confident
A Disability Confident employer will generally offer an interview to any applicant that declares they have a disability and meets the minimum criteria for the job as defined by the employer. It is important to note that in certain recruitment situations such as high-volume, seasonal and high-peak times, the employer may wish to limit the overall numbers of interviews offered to both disabled people and non-disabled people.
